5057752575 has 12 divisors (see below), whose sum is σ = 8362151048. Its totient is φ = 2697468000.
The previous prime is 5057752573. The next prime is 5057752577. The reversal of 5057752575 is 5752577505.
It is an interprime number because it is at equal distance from previous prime (5057752573) and next prime (5057752577).
It is not a de Polignac number, because 5057752575 - 21 = 5057752573 is a prime.
It is a super-2 number, since 2×50577525752 = 51161722219838261250, which contains 22 as substring.
It is a Duffinian number.
It is a congruent number.
It is not an unprimeable number, because it can be changed into a prime (5057752571) by changing a digit.
It is a pernicious number, because its binary representation contains a prime number (23) of ones.
It is a polite number, since it can be written in 11 ways as a sum of consecutive naturals, for example, 33718276 + ... + 33718425.
Almost surely, 25057752575 is an apocalyptic number.
5057752575 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(3304398473).
5057752575 is a wasteful number, since it uses less digits than its factorization.
5057752575 is an odious number, because the sum of its binary digits is odd.
The sum of its prime factors is 67436714 (or 67436709 counting only the distinct ones).
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 2143750, while the sum is 48.
The square root of 5057752575 is about 71117.8780265553. The cubic root of 5057752575 is about 1716.5344606558.
The spelling of 5057752575 in words is "five billion, fifty-seven million, seven hundred fifty-two thousand, five hundred seventy-five".
